Modeling Copyright and Fair Use
It is important for educators to understand the impact of copyright and fair use. In this section you will be asked to identify the impact of digital citizenship by staff and students. Let's begin by looking at the importance of copyright and fair use.
Your leadership starts by modeling your vision and expectations. Begin by exploring Thing 9: Be Legal & Fair which describes the elements of Copyright, Creative Commons, Fair Use, and the Teach Act in education.
- View the video to get started then visit the Creative Commons site and experiment with creating your own CC for an original work.

What does your staff need to know about copyright and fair use?
As you move through the contents, consider what your staff needs to know and the impact on their practice. What documents, materials, or works should include the Creative Commons license? How might you share out valuable tools like the plagiarism checkers with your staff? For more ideas, review the Administrator and Teacher Guidelines for Copyright.
